Abstract

Automatic mucosa marking biopsy forceps comprise a handle, a sliding handle, a forceps arm and a forceps head, wherein a micro-syringe is arranged inside the handle, the front end of the micro-syringe is connected with a miniature injection needle tube, an injection needle head is arranged on the end portion of the injection needle tube, the injection needle head is arranged in a sheath tube in an inserted mode, and the sheath tube is arranged on the lower end portion of the forceps arm. A clamping block is arranged on the front end portion of the micro-syringe, one end of the clamping block is arranged on a long-strip-shaped through hole in a clamped mode, the long-strip-shaped through hole is formed in the handle, and the other end of the micro-syringe is connected to an elastic button. A groove is formed in the portion, corresponding to the clamping block, inside the sliding handle, and the groove is formed corresponding to the long-strip-shaped through hole. A syringe wedge-shaped tail end is arranged at the rear end of the micro-syringe, and a tail portion wedge-shaped groove corresponding to the wedge-shaped portion of the syringe wedge-shaped tail end is further formed in the handle. A handle wedge-shaped embossment is arranged on the position, corresponding to the tail portion wedge-shaped groove, of a portion of the sliding handle, and the portion of the sliding handle slides and moves along the handle. A sliding groove corresponding to the handle wedge-shaped embossment is formed in the handle. The automatic mucosa marking biopsy forceps can take biopsies while completing marking of a biopsy portion, and the automatic mucosa marking biopsy forceps are convenient to operate.

Description

technical field [0001] The invention relates to a medical device, in particular to an automatic mucosal marker biopsy forceps. Background technique [0002] In modern medicine, in order to obtain information on certain diseased parts of the human body cavity, doctors usually use biopsy forceps to clamp some diseased tissue in the human body cavity for detection, so as to obtain the diagnosis and treatment method of the disease by analyzing the diseased tissue. [0003] Currently, the commonly used function is relatively single, and only the diseased tissue of the corresponding part can be obtained. Sometimes in order to find the lesion during subsequent reexamination or determine the lesion as soon as possible during laparotomy, it is necessary to mark the biopsy site while using biopsy forceps to take the lesion.
